The Lishman Library is a space for reading, research and creativity - from our youngest learners in Education and Care through to our almost-graduates preparing for their final exams. It’s a place to settle in, find what you need, find a good book, follow an idea, test a thought and work things through, page by page.
Opening hours throughout the school term are:
Monday to Thursday - 8am to 5pm
Friday - 8am to 4pm

Our Library is brought to life by a team of warm, knowledgeable staff who make it both a calm retreat and a space full of energy. Alongside supporting reading and research, they run writing workshops, host visiting authors and lead creative projects throughout the year - shaping a library that feels welcoming, engaging and quietly alive with ideas.
